Built an MCP to publish vibe coded games
cody-fifth-door · reddit · 2026-08-21
The author built a Model Context Protocol (MCP) tool designed to give users a platform to publish "vibe coded" games. This MCP allows these games to be integrated into environments that support the protocol.
